COMMUNITY PAGE| News You Can Use Club Traffic or any other establishment that operates at that location has been placed off limits for all U.S. military personnel until fur- ther notice. The club located at Hafnargata 30 in Keflavik. This action is in part to an incident that occurred early Saturday morning, where a U.S. service member was stabbed by another foreign national just outside the club. The status of the club will remain in effect until rescinded or superseded by proper authori- ties.
